The Bedford Branch of the Morris Minor Owners’ Club would like to thank all those who took part in helping to restore this car ”Maisie” for the Kids in Action and the Base Club charity in Dunstable
Lloyd Wilson for donating the car to the charity
Fieldside Garage, Mauldon for inspection and MOT
S Savage for the under-floor reconstruction and welding.
R Waters for the disc brake conversion
Flitwick Garage for the wheel check and air valves
A Wilson for the carpet edging
R Gazeley for sign writing
MMOC Bedford Branch for time and labour

Extract from the Kids in Action Charity website:
“Paul, the charity CEO, gave a talk at the Bedfordshire Morris Minor Owners Club and was inspired by their passion for restoring classic cars. He mentioned that a Morris Minor would be a great asset for the charity, and the club members were enthusiastic about the idea. They took the initiative to write an article in the National Morris Minors Club magazine, explaining their desire to find a car for our charity. Fortunately, their appeal caught the attention of a generous donor who offered to donate a Morris Minor, despite needing significant restoration work. The BMMOC club gladly took on the challenge of restoring the car. They poured their time, effort, and expertise into bringing the car back to its former glory. The result was a stunning restoration, and the car was lovingly named “Maisie.” In 2025, “Maisie” will be gracing car shows and school fetes across the region, raising awareness and funds for Kids in Action. This incredible partnership between the Bedfordshire Morris Minor Owners Club and Kids in Action is a testament to the power of community and the generosity of car enthusiasts.”
